In 1492, Columbus discovered the New World of the Americas.

In the following centuries, Spain savagely plundered a large amount of gold, silver, precious stones, sugar, coffee, etc. in South America.

Spain used merchant s.h.i.+ps or formed a fleet of gold to transport these huge wealth back to Spain.

After the British, French and Dutch countries rushed to plunder the wealth of the New World, they must compete with Spain, which has already achieved the dominance of the Caribbean. Therefore, it needs various forces to attack the Spaniards. When the naval power of the country is insufficient or inconvenient to directly come out, The Various government have adopted the method of issuing private licenses to encourage civilian vessels to attack the merchant s.h.i.+ps of the Spaniard.

Many Spanish merchant s.h.i.+ps and gold transporters sank on the seabed due to 'legitimate' pirate attacks and sea storms.

From the South American colonies to the Spanish mainland, a large number of Spanish vessels carrying gold, silver, precious stones, sugar, coffee and other materials plundered in the colonies of South America were sunk.

in 2007, the American salvage company Odyssey Ocean Exploration and the Spanish frigate "Mercedes" was, loaded with 17 tons aboard treasures, including 590,000 gold coins, silver coins and other gold ornaments, utensils and artifacts, worth up to $ 500 million that was the largest s.h.i.+pwreck wealth in the history of the s.h.i.+pwreck.

Since then, the Spanish government and the Odyssey Ocean Exploration Company have been fighting for the owners.h.i.+p of the treasure for five years, and finally, the Justice City Court of Florida ruled These treasures should be returned to Spain.

However, Spain's success in recovering the treasures on the "Mercedes" frigate is very rare in the world.

The main reason for this successful recovery of the artifacts is the identification of the "Mercedes" s.h.i.+pwreck. It is a wars.h.i.+p, a wars.h.i.+p is a state property, and the act of transporting treasure belongs to the country behavior, Spain has a legitimate right to belong "Mercedes" wreck.
